A moon of Saturn, named after Atlas the Titan.

Atlas was discovered by [R. Terrile]? in 1980 from Voyager? photos. It seems to be a shepherd satellite of the A ring.

*Orbital radius: 137,670 km
*diameter: 30 km (40 x 20)
*mass: Unknown
*Orbital period: 0.6019 days
*Orbital inclination: 0°
